About SNIPS

Scientists for National and International Peace and Security (SNIPS) is a graduate student organization dedicated to sharing research in the sciences and engineering with an interdisciplinary audience. Through informal discussion events we aim to foster cross-disciplinary research and collaboration on issues related to global peace and security, with particular focus placed on devising solutions for environmental driven conflict.

SNIPS was formed in 2010 by a group of science and engineering graduate students at Columbia University who recognized the challenges to and potential for cross-disciplinary collaboration within and outside of the university. The organization was founded on the idea that by sharing student research  regarding topics of mutual interest in an informal setting, we can not only promote interdisciplinary collaborations but also mutual respect between disciplines.
